
Biography
Dr. Laura A. Swingen embarked on her chiropractic profession after graduating from the University of Oregon in 1986 and Western States Chiropractic College in 1990. She gained experience as an associate doctor, learning the NUCCA technique, before joining Sunset Chiropractic Clinic in 1991, where she has served thousands of patients over her more than 34-year career. Dr. Swingen has also participated in three chiropractic mission trips to Central America, providing much-needed care to hundreds of people. In 2010, Dr. Swingen pursued advanced studies in Chiropractic Neurology, completing 475 classroom hours and passing a rigorous board examination to earn her certification in 2012. This achievement made her one of only a handful of Chiropractic Neurologists in Oregon, allowing her to assist patients with greater precision and attracting referrals for complex cases from colleagues statewide. She is known for her compassionate and persistent approach, blending various chiropractic techniques with extensive clinical skill to achieve optimal patient outcomes. Dr. Swingen is an active member of the chiropractic community, holding the presidency of the Functional Chiropractic Council within the Oregon Chiropractic Association. She is also a member of the International Chiropractic Association, the American Chiropractic Association, and the American Chiropractic Neurology Board, and is a founding member of the International Association of Functional Neurology and Rehabilitation. Her commitment to ongoing education includes over 600 hours of training in the treatment of concussion and mild traumatic brain injury. Dr. Swingen has contributed to peer-reviewed literature, publishing research on neurological rehabilitation in Integrative Medicine: A Clinician's Journal (April/May 2017), and was honored as Chiropractor of the Year in 2023 by the Oregon Chiropractic Association.
